这里是文章模块栏目内容页
跨机房redis集群不足(redis集群高可用原理,一台挂了,怎么切换到另一台)

导读:Redis是一种高性能的键值存储系统,常用于缓存、消息队列和数据结构存储。在分布式系统中,跨机房部署Redis集群可以提高系统的可用性和性能,但同时也存在一些不足之处。

1. 网络延迟:跨机房部署Redis集群会增加网络延迟,可能导致请求响应时间变慢,影响系统性能。

2. 数据同步:由于跨机房Redis集群的节点分布在不同的物理位置,数据同步需要通过网络传输,当网络带宽不足或者网络故障时,可能会导致数据同步失败,进而影响系统的可用性。

3. 节点失效:跨机房Redis集群的节点分布在不同的物理位置,当某个节点失效时,需要通过网络将该节点的数据同步到其他节点,这个过程可能会导致数据不一致,需要进行手动修复。

4. 部署复杂:跨机房Redis集群需要考虑网络拓扑、数据同步、负载均衡等问题,需要投入更多的人力和物力成本。

总结:跨机房Redis集群是一种提高系统可用性和性能的有效手段,但同时也存在一些不足之处,需要在实际应用中根据具体情况进行权衡和选择。